Jake Roberts recently appeared on the Busted Open radio show and spoke about not being in the WWE Hall of Fame. Here is what he had to say…
“There’s been a lot of guys go in that belong there, and…there are some who shouldn’t be in there, but who the hell am I? Hell, I’m not in there, so what the hell. Maybe someday when they put some more guys in there, maybe I’ll go in. I would love to go in, not so much for me, but for my kids, man. It’s part of my legacy. I put so much into wrestling; 37 years of it. Why I’m not there, I’m sure somebody’s got a reason.”
He also addressed WWE possibly being scared to take a chance on him…
“I don’t think it’s the past. I think it’s just me, period, because of what I believe in… I’m a team player because I want the product better, but… my nose doesn’t fit well up anybody’s butt.”
